Boboo Lall Jain, J. : This is an appeal from the judgment and order of the learned Single Judge made in the exercise of the constitutional writ jurisdiction of this Court. The appellant National Textile Corporation, (WBABO) Ltd, (hereinafter also referred to as N.TC.) appointed the respondents nos. 1 to 4 between 13th July, 1983 to 7th January, 1984, as trainees for different posts. Plaban Kumar Das was selected as trainee Supervisor (SQC), Mritunjoy Samaddar was selected as a trainee for the post of Supervisor (Electrical), Ranjit Kumar Ghosh was selected as a trainee Supervisor (Legal) and Partha Chakraborty was selected as a trainee (Internal Audit). The initial selection as trainee in all these cases was for a period of one year from the respective dates of their selection. The terms and conditions inter alia provided that they will get during the said period of one year a stipend of Rs. 500/-. They were also directed that they will be posted to different factories of the appellant during the training period.
